DATAVES

Authors: De Observadores De Aves, Red Nacional;
Abstract

El recurso presenta un listado de observaciones de aves para Colombia desde 1948 hasta 2011, se presenta un listado total de 413272 registros de aves con información sobre su taxonomía y zonas de distribución geográfica. El cual es producto de la recopilación de diversas iniciativas, entre las que se encuentran: DATAves base de datos de la Red Nacional de Observadores de Aves RNOA, Monitoreo de Avifauna del valle del Cerrejón, Café con sombra y reserva forestal como corredores biológicos, Censos Navideños de la Red nacional de Observadores de Aves, Monitoreos ambientales minas Pribe Now y el Descanso, recorridos en cauces de ríos y quebradas en el programa de monitoreo de fiebre amarilla. Este conjunto de datos fue creado originalmente por la Sociedad Antioqueña de Ornitología (SAO) y fue adoptado por la RNOA en el año 2007 y modificado al estándar de registros biológicos actual por las partes asociadas con los recursos de las organizaciones que son mencionadas como fuentes de financiación.
